文件名称:gandi-ddns:更新GANDI DNS记录的应用程序
文件大小:25KB
文件格式:ZIP
更新时间:2024-06-17 16:10:10
JavaScript
甘地DDNS 一种简单的服务,可轮询您的公共IP或防火墙配置并更新一组GANDI dns记录。 当前支持以下来源: API以纯文本形式返回ip,例如https://api.ipify.org 启用了SonicOS API的Sonicwall。 入门 这些说明将为您提供在本地计算机上运行并运行的项目的副本,以进行开发和测试。 有关如何在实时系统上部署项目的注释,请参阅部署。 先决条件 在开始之前,请确保已安装NodeJS 12或更高版本。 如果您使用的是Sonicwall,则还需要确保已启用SonicOS API并允许HTTP基本身份验证。 正在安装 将存储库克隆到您的首选位置 git clone https://github.com/karlenek/gandi-ddns.git 安装所有依赖项 cd ./gandi-ddns npm install 在运行该应用程序之前,您需要
【文件预览】:
gandi-ddns-master
----.gitignore(44B)
----Dockerfile(127B)
----package.json(409B)
----package-lock.json(50KB)
----src()
--------index.js(3KB)
--------config.js(3KB)
--------logger.js(331B)
--------gandi.js(1KB)
--------cache.js(953B)
--------sources()
----LICENSE.md(1KB)
----.dockerignore(45B)
----index.js(23B)
----config_example.json(462B)
----docker-compose.yaml(147B)
----README.md(2KB)